    Raytheon Intelligence & Space (RI&S) is looking for an individual to join the Cyber Security Engineering team for a Senior Cyber Security Engineer position supporting the operations and maintenance of custom solutions and Assessment & Authorization (A&A) activities in Aurora, Colorado.  This position requires an existing Secret clearance to start. Top Secret/SCI Clearance is preferred.  Position will work on-site at Aurora campus.

    Responsibilities Include:

    • Use Static Code Analysis tool (Fortify) to review, adjudicate and provide security-focused feedback to software developers on source code written in both Java and C++

    • Coordinate with software developers for the resolution of Fortify findings

    • Prepare IA charts for software releases showing the results of the Fortify scans

    • Brief leadership on the Fortify findings & security status for of all software releases

    • Maintain and update a log for all Fortify findings for future reference

    • Coordinate with the government accreditors to adjudicate Fortify findings and false positives

    • Applying knowledge of existing government and approved industry IA policies and standards as a contributor to the design of secure architecture and solutions to customer needs and requirements

    Clearance Requirement:  Must be a US Citizen with an active DOD Secret clearance. Top Secret/SCI Clearance is preferred
